Hard as hell, though. Think WoW before they implemented phasing. How can you possibly synchronize the game state between every single commander in a cohesive manner? If things change, they either change for everyone, or nobody. If they change for everyone, the leading edge of players change the world and everyone is along for the ride. If they change for nobody, then nothing ever changes and it's pointless. Currently, we're seeing the latter option. (With BGS tacked on.)

Phasing lets MMOs display, say, a burning city to people on that part of the story line, and a living city to those on THAT part. But ED is very much not set up for that, and would be extremely difficult. Probably impossible, IMO.
